Abstract

With rapid urbanization, the cities are facing unique problems in the country's natural resources, history, society, economy and culture in China at the same time. One of them is the environment problem especially frequent extremely hot weather which does harm to people’s health and lowers the quality of urban life. Researches have found that the layout and structure of the city have important effects onthe problem. Residential communities, as the most important part of Chinese cities, occupy the largest proportion of the urban land. So their own thermal environment make great contribution to the thermal environment of the whole city correspondingly. This paper focuses more on the thermal environment of residential communities and takes three famous residential communities built in different times in the city of Beijing as cases. Records is showing that the temperature and the population is getting higher over time. The thermal environment problem will be more serious and should be paid more attention. In conclusion, the paper tries to study the thermal environment of three typical residential communities. This research extracts the plane of the communities and then simulates the thermal environment by using the software named ENVI-met, a holistic three-dimensional non-hydrostatic model for the simulation of surface-plant-air interactions often used to simulate urban environments and to assess the effects of green architecture visions, and then analyzes the results of the air temperature. After analyzing the results, the paper will point out some strategies of improvement and planning advice for future communities.
